Info Density Power-words vs. Substance ratio.
8 Impact Weight: 30 / 100
27% BS

Substance is exceptionally high across all product pages, citing specific metrics such as 20g of complete protein, 90g of carbs for high-carb fuel, and 310mg of sodium per serving. Heading fluff is nearly non-existent, with H2 and H3 tags used for specific product names or functional benefits like REBUILD MUSCLE and REPLENISH GLYCOGEN STORES. The body substance ratio is dense with technical ingredients like Fava Protein Isolate and Non-GMO Dextrose, leaving little room for generic marketing filler. Concept repetition of the stomach-friendly value prop occurs 5+ times, but is anchored by the founder’s unique Leadville 100 narrative.

Semantic Coherence Homepage promise vs. Sub-page reality.
0 Impact Weight: 20 / 100
0% BS

The homepage H1/Hero signal for clean, stomach-friendly fuel is perfectly supported by the technical specifications found on the sub-pages. There is zero drift between the marketing promise of endurance nutrition and the delivery of specific carbohydrate-to-fructose ratios on the product pages. Navigation and product categories (Hydration, Fuel, Recovery) are logically consistent across the entire crawl. Sub-pages provide even deeper granularity, such as the Starter Kit page which explicitly details the exact number of sticks and flavors included, reinforcing the honest signal of the homepage.

Trust & Proof Verifiable evidence vs. Trust Theatre.
4 Impact Weight: 20 / 100
20% BS

Trust is supported by a massive review volume (e.g., 4,041 reviews for Mandarin Endurance Fuel) with a verified buyer badge system, as seen in the clean_text for the Recovery Mix. While the review count is high, the proof_links_count of 2 per page indicates a reliance on internal verification rather than external clinical citations. Temporal credibility is high, with reviews dated within days and weeks of the May 2026 anchor. No trust_theatre_flag was triggered as reviews appear verified via 3rd party Okendo schema.

The ratio of verifiable technical data to vague assertions is high, approximately 5:1. Specific proof points include exact mineral weights (calcium, magnesium, potassium), the complete profile of all 9 essential amino acids, and the specific WHO hydration standards met. Vague marketing assertions are rare and usually serves as a bridge to the technical ingredient list.

Commodity Fingerprint Detection of industry clichés/templates.
1 Impact Weight: 15 / 100
7% BS

The brand avoids almost every cliché in the provided gym dictionary, eschewing phrases like transform your body or best gym in town. The value proposition is highly differentiated, focusing on the specific gastrointestinal failures of standard fuel and using a founder-led failure story to establish a unique position. Boilerplate sections are restricted to the Best Sellers and footer, with the majority of text focused on technical product delivery. The focus on fava bean protein sustainability and amino acid profiles distinguishes it from generic commodity supplements.

Identity & Authority Expert verifiability & Schema depth.
1 Impact Weight: 15 / 100
7% BS

Authority is established through the named founder, Jeff Vierling, and a roster of professional athletes including Courtney Dauwalter and Christopher Blevins, all of whom have established digital footprints. The schema_json is robust, providing detailed Organization and Product data, sameAs links, and a clear founding story dating back to 2012. The only minor authority gap is a technical one: the homepage lacks a formal H1 tag, though the schema provides the necessary identity data.

Tailwind avoids hyperbolic performance claims, opting for functional descriptions of how dextrose and sucrose match what the body is designed to absorb. Claims regarding recovery are specific to muscle repair and glycogen replenishment rather than vague fitness results. Testimony from athletes like Courtney Dauwalter provides contextual proof of product performance during specific high-stakes race scenarios.
